

The Master of Science in Mechanical Engineering - Mastertrack High-tech Systems at Eindhoven University of Technology (TU/e) is a two-year, full-time on-campus program that focuses on the design, development, and integration of high-tech systems used in advanced industries. The program combines mechanical engineering with cutting-edge technologies such as robotics, automation, and precision engineering. Students will gain expertise in system integration, high-precision manufacturing, and advanced control systems, preparing them to create complex, high-performance systems used in sectors like aerospace, automotive, and high-tech manufacturing.
Graduates will be well-prepared for careers in high-tech systems design, automation engineering, and precision manufacturing. Eindhoven University of Technology (TU/e) offers access to state-of-the-art research facilities, industry partnerships, and hands-on learning experiences, ensuring students develop the skills necessary to lead in the high-tech engineering sector.
